The most playful of L. Frank Baum’s Oz adventures, The Road to Oz is more of a delightful ramble than a fateful quest. At home in Kansas, Dorothy Gale and her faithful dog Toto set out to show the kindly wanderer Shaggy Man how to reach a nearby town. But the road splits into impossible paths that carry them into a series of fantastic lands.

On their journey, they meet Button-Bright, a boy who’s always lost, and Polychrome, the radiant sky fairy. Everyone’s bound for Princess Ozma’s glittering birthday celebration in the Emerald City—crossing deserts, dodging dangers, and gathering friends along the way. Cheerful and full of creative sparkle, The Road to Oz reads like a carefree trip through the brightest corners of Baum’s imagination.
